Output 804e3193ea33fb0013012f144b47b59abbef1b15f4acdf6128a054a5b144c7b9:2

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2974bc5d59cccedbe0728a051295e18256287269 OP_EQUAL
address
2Mw2RY6SH5xF8n76wiWHejopf1QwAuMwwV6
transaction
804e3193ea33fb0013012f144b47b59abbef1b15f4acdf6128a054a5b144c7b9
confirmations
21287
spent
false

1 Sat Range